Amendment Since initial award the total obligations have decreased 7% from $32,991,054 to $30,560,338.
Jacksonville Transportation Authority was awarded
Project Grant FL-2020-002
worth $16,495,527
from the FTA Office of Budget and Policy in January 2020 with work to be completed primarily in Florida United States.
The grant
has a duration of 7 years 2 months and
was awarded through assistance program 20.500 Federal Transit Capital Investment Grants.
$14,064,811 (46.0%) of this Project Grant was funded by non-federal sources.
